Is 91000993 a prime number?
It is possible to find out using mathematical methods whether a given integer is a prime number or not.
No, 91 000 993 is not a prime number.
For example, 91 000 993 can be divided by 2 063: 91 000 993 / 2063 = 44 111.
For 91 000 993 to be a prime number, it would have been required that 91 000 993 has only two divisors, i.e., itself and 1.
